No Bongo Ting Kwa Kwa

Two silly scientists can't agree on the best way to use their laboratory equipment in this weird and delightful combination of music, puppetry and animation.  

Puppets performed by:

Walter Santucci

Yoriko Murakami

Music by:

Detroit Illharmonic


© 2018 by Evil Cat Land... all rights reserved... all wrongs reversed

tweet us nice:
  • Twitter Classic